Reflecting on the Gen AI Exchange Hackathon by Google

Google India, supported by the MEITY Startup Hub and Startup India, hosted a nationwide Gen AI Exchange Hackathon to catalyze innovation through generative AI. With over 38,000 participants, the initiative focused on solving challenges in sectors like finance, healthcare, manufacturing, and cybersecurity. Through mentorship, roadshows, and access to cutting-edge tools like Gemini AI, the event cultivated an open ecosystem where young builders and startups could co-create solutions with real-world impact.

Key Ideas

  1. Generative AI as a Catalyst: Builders used tools like Gemini AI to create applications spanning robotic automation, predictive diagnostics, secure data workflows, and personalized services.

  2. India-Focused Innovation: Solutions targeted specific regional challenges, such as low-tech accessibility, workforce optimization, and scalable healthcare, wich showcases AI’s adaptability.

  3. Industry-Driven Collaboration: Startups and developers interacted with venture capitalists, corporates, and policy partners to refine their ideas into fundable, scalable ventures.

The hackathon validates generative AI’s power to solve high-impact problems across domains. Whether it’s integrating Gemini AI with RPA for industrial automation or fine-tuning models for vernacular data, there’s space to build both vertical-specific tools and horizontal platforms. Developers should explore regional datasets and open APIs to localize solutions and contribute to broader AI adoption.
